Choosing The Best Kitchen Sink
When it comes to renovating your kitchen or simply upgrading your existing sink, the options can feel overwhelming. From materials like stainless steel, granite composite, and fireclay to a range of shapes and sizes, finding the right match for your needs requires careful thought. This guide will walk you through the important factors to consider when picking a kitchen sink, helping you make an informed decision that suits both your style and practicality.
- Initially, determine your budget. Kitchen sinks come in a broad spectrum in price, so set a realistic limit before you start browsing.
- Secondly, consider the size and shape of your kitchen and existing countertops. Measure your space carefully to ensure a proper match.
- Lastly, think about your daily habits in the kitchen. Do you frequently clean large items? Do you need a deep sink for soaking?
